Intel NIC woes in the ESX world

E-mail Print PDF

Well... apparently Intel is no longer making the Intel VT gigabit NIC's :(

And they decided not to tell us until last week :)

 

We had 15 new ESX hosts come in the door, all sporting the brand new Intel 82576 Gigabit Ethernet Adapter... And all of the sudden our builds were failing :(

I took a quick check at the HCL and saw the 82576 is clearly supported, however it is NOT included in the 4.0 update 1 installation media :(

A quick Google search and it appears that quite a few other people are having the same exact issue!

A result that popped up was- http://patrickvanbeek.wordpress.com/2010/01/30/slipstreaming-drivers-in-the-esx4i-install-iso/

I'll be trying that on Monday to see if I can get it to work!   

 

Enabling iSCSI multi-pathing on your ESX host for Dell EqualLogic arrays

E-mail Print PDF

After looking this up 20 different times, I decided to add it to my blog so that I could find it back easily :)

 esxcli nmp satp setdefaultpsp -psp VMW_PSP_RR -satp VMW_SATP_EQL
